Răsfoiți Sursa

Updated cache test check for no store header to use availability checks.

Christian Noon 9 ani în urmă
părinte
comite
2ee092aeb3
1 a modificat fișierele cu 6 adăugiri și 8 ștergeri
  1. 6 8
      Tests/CacheTests.swift

+ 6 - 8
Tests/CacheTests.swift

@@ -239,17 +239,15 @@ class CacheTestCase: BaseTestCase {
     // MARK: - Cache Helper Methods
 
     private func isCachedResponseForNoStoreHeaderExpected() -> Bool {
-        var storedInCache = false
-
         #if os(iOS)
-            let operatingSystemVersion = NSOperatingSystemVersion(majorVersion: 8, minorVersion: 3, patchVersion: 0)
-
-            if !NSProcessInfo().isOperatingSystemAtLeastVersion(operatingSystemVersion) {
-                storedInCache = true
+            if #available(iOS 8.3, *) {
+                return false
+            } else {
+                return true
             }
+        #else
+            return false
         #endif
-
-        return storedInCache
     }
 
     // MARK: - Tests